Home Depot has 22-Piece Ryobi Oscillating Blade & Sand Paper Set (A242201) on sale for $19.97. Shipping is free or select free ship to store pickup where available.

Note: Availability for store pickup may vary.

Thanks to Deal Hunter idk_then for finding this deal.

Includes:
  • (2) 1-1/8" Plunge Cut Wood
  • (1) 1-1/4" Japanese Teeth Blade
  • (1) 3/8" Offset Plunge Cut
  • (2) 3-1/2" Wood / Drywall Flush Cut
  • (1) Sand Paper Backer Pad (for 80mm pad)
  • (5) 60 grit sand paper (for 80mm pad)
  • (5) 120 grit sand paper (for 80mm pad)
  • (5) 240 grit sand paper (for 80mm pad)

All of these cheap blades have an incredibly short life span. Carbide tipped ones are much more expensive, but also last much longer.

If you're just making a quick cut here or there, any cheap blade (or 2 or 3 of them as needed) will do. If you're doing a lot of work, or using this for work, I think it's worth it to go carbide.
